#ifndef LIBKC3_MARSHALL_H
#define LIBKC3_MARSHALL_H
#include "types.h"
#define MARSHALL_MAGIC ((u64) 0x485352414d33434b)
#define PROTO_MARSHALL(name, type) \
s_marshall * marshall_ ## name (s_marshall *m, bool heap, type src)
/* Stack-allocation compatible functions, call marshall_clean
after use. */
void marshall_clean (s_marshall *m);
s_marshall * marshall_init (s_marshall *m);
/* Heap-allocation functions, call marshall_delete after use. */
void marshall_delete (s_marshall *m);
s_marshall * marshall_new (void);
/* Observers. */
sw marshall_size (const s_marshall *m);
/* Operators. */
